Группа :: Other
Пакет: bemenu
Главная Изменения Спек Патчи Sources Загрузить Gear Bugs and FR Repocop
Патч: respect-env-build-flags.patch
Скачать
Скачать
diff -up 0.6.0/GNUmakefile.orig 0.6.0/GNUmakefile
--- 0.6.0/GNUmakefile.orig 2021-05-20 15:27:51.181168867 +0200
+++ 0.6.0/GNUmakefile 2021-05-20 15:28:02.489222506 +0200
@@ -12,9 +12,9 @@ MAKEFLAGS += --no-builtin-rules
WARNINGS = -Wall -Wextra -Wpedantic -Wformat=2 -Wstrict-aliasing=3 -Wstrict-overflow=5 -Wstack-usage=12500 \
-Wfloat-equal -Wcast-align -Wpointer-arith -Wchar-subscripts -Warray-bounds=2 -Wno-unknown-warning-option
-override CFLAGS ?= -g -O2 $(WARNINGS) $(EXTRA_WARNINGS)
+override CFLAGS += -g -O2 $(WARNINGS) $(EXTRA_WARNINGS)
override CFLAGS += -std=c99
-override CPPFLAGS ?= -D_FORTIFY_SOURCE=2
+override CPPFLAGS += -D_FORTIFY_SOURCE=2
override CPPFLAGS += -DBM_VERSION=\"$(VERSION)\" -DBM_PLUGIN_VERSION=\"$(VERSION)-$(GIT_SHA1)\" -DINSTALL_LIBDIR=\"$(PREFIX)$(libdir)\"
override CPPFLAGS += -D_DEFAULT_SOURCE -Ilib